Is The Smoked Salmon In A Philadelphia Roll Raw?

A Philadelphia Roll is an inside-out sushi roll (meaning the rice is on the outside) that typically is made with smoked or raw salmon as the protein. Philadelphia roll ingredients also include cream cheese, cucumber, and spicy mayo sauce to give it an extra kick.

Is smoked salmon in sushi cooked or raw?

Depending on where you get your sushi, you can either get cold smoked salmon (raw) or hot smoked salmon (cooked). To make sure that you’re getting the type of salmon that you want, remember to ask for more details before ordering.

Can you eat smoked salmon right out of the package?

Both types of smoked salmon can be eaten cold right out of the package. Hot-smoked salmon can also be reheated and is great in hot dishes. Unlike fresh salmon, which should be prepared and eaten within 48 hours, smoked salmon has a longer shelf life. It can be enjoyed for up to a week.

Why does smoked salmon look raw?

Most smoked salmon is dry-cured in a large amount of salt for days, which draws out a lot of the moisture. Then it’s smoked in temperatures below 80°F. The cold smoke doesn’t actually cook the fish, so it’s left with an almost raw-like texture.

Is smoked salmon safe for pregnancy?

Pregnant women can safely eat hot-smoked salmon when heated to 165℉ or shelf-stable forms, but cold-smoked salmon puts you at risk of tapeworm and Listeria infections. You should never eat uncooked cold-smoked salmon if you’re pregnant.

Why is it called a Philadelphia roll?

It can also include other ingredients such as cucumber, avocado, onion and sesame seed. The name “Philly roll” incorporates smoked salmon lox and Philadelphia brand cream cheese, originating from the two ingredients’ famous pairing on a sliced bagel.

Is California roll Raw?

Q: Are California Roll ingredients raw or cooked? A: Everything is cooked except the cucumber and avocado. California rolls typically roll imitation crab meat which is a type of fishcake. So it is not raw fish.

Is smoked salmon healthier than raw salmon?

Smoked salmon is an excellent source of protein, numerous vitamins, and omega-3 fatty acids. Yet, it’s much higher in sodium than fresh salmon.
